About

Funan Chen is a scholar working on Materials Chemistry, Mechanical Engineering and Molecular Biology. According to data from OpenAlex, Funan Chen has authored 47 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 24 papers in Materials Chemistry, 11 papers in Mechanical Engineering and 10 papers in Molecular Biology. Recurrent topics in Funan Chen's work include Advanced Nanomaterials in Catalysis (11 papers), Nanocluster Synthesis and Applications (9 papers) and Cavitation Phenomena in Pumps (7 papers). Funan Chen is often cited by papers focused on Advanced Nanomaterials in Catalysis (11 papers), Nanocluster Synthesis and Applications (9 papers) and Cavitation Phenomena in Pumps (7 papers). Funan Chen collaborates with scholars based in China. Funan Chen's co-authors include Longqin Li, Zuxin She, Qing Li, Juncen Zhou, Zhongwei Wang, Zhongwei Wang, Mao Deng, Shuangjiao Xu, Qing Li and Zhujun Zhang and has published in prestigious journals such as Chemical Engineering Journal, ACS Applied Materials & Interfaces and Journal of Materials Chemistry.
